Squamous vs. Non-Squamous NSCLC: What's the Difference
Squamous cell carcinoma and non-squamous NSCLC (primarily adenocarcinoma) are the two broad NSCLC categories, distinguished by how the cancer cells appear under a microscope, with different typical treatment approaches and biomarker patterns.
Squamous cell carcinoma begins in the flat cells lining the airways and has historically been more strongly associated with smoking history than adenocarcinoma. Adenocarcinoma, the most common non-squamous subtype, begins in mucus-producing cells and occurs more frequently in never-smokers.
Actionable driver mutations such as EGFR, ALK, and ROS1 are considerably more common in non-squamous NSCLC (particularly adenocarcinoma) than in squamous cell carcinoma, which has historically meant fewer targeted therapy options for squamous patients and a heavier reliance on immunotherapy and chemotherapy combinations.
Recent trial data, including the phase 3 HARMONi-6 study testing a dual PD-1/VEGF-targeting antibody, has specifically focused on improving outcomes for squamous NSCLC patients without a targetable driver mutation โ a population that has had comparatively fewer treatment advances than biomarker-positive non-squamous NSCLC in recent years.

Which is more common, squamous or non-squamous NSCLC?
Adenocarcinoma (non-squamous) has become the most common NSCLC subtype in many countries over recent decades.
Do squamous and non-squamous NSCLC get treated the same way?
Not always โ treatment planning considers subtype alongside biomarker testing results, since targetable mutations occur at different rates between the two categories.
